Simeon Schreiber

Simeon Schreiber is a senior chaplain and a certified grief counselor with extensive experience in providing spiritual care and guidance. He specializes in bereavement counseling, helping individuals and families navigate the complex emotional landscapes that accompany loss. His approach integrates traditional pastoral care with modern psychological insights, offering a holistic support system to those in mourning.

Throughout his career, Schreiber has worked in various healthcare settings, including hospitals, hospices, and community health organizations. His work focuses on crisis intervention, end-of-life care, and facilitating grief support groups. Schreiber's compassionate approach helps individuals find meaning and healing in the midst of grief, providing them with the tools to rebuild their lives after loss.

In addition to his clinical practice, Simeon Schreiber is an educator and author. He conducts workshops and seminars on grief and bereavement, aiming to educate healthcare professionals and the public on effective coping strategies and the importance of grief support. His writings contribute valuable insights into the fields of death, dying, and bereavement, making complex psychological and spiritual concepts accessible to a broader audience.
